The salary of part-time employees shall be determined by reference to <br /> the salary grade to which the employee's position classification is <br /> assigned. The part-time employee's salary shall be such proportionate <br /> part of the full-time annual salary as reflects the hours worked by the <br /> part-time employee, at the minimum range. Part-time employees shall <br /> receive salary increases only when the minimum range for the <br /> established grade increases. Temporary Employment <br /> <br /> A position is defined as temporary when it is for a specific limited <br /> time without regard to the number of scheduled hours. These <br /> positions are not entitled to benefits, are paid from funds designated <br /> as part-time, and paid based on minimum range for the graded <br /> position. Increases would only be granted if the minimum range wage <br /> increases for that grade. <br /> <br />e. Creation of New Positions <br /> <br /> All new positions must be authorized by the City Manager prior to the <br /> establishment of the new position; the Department Head involved <br /> shall complete a Position Questionnaire covering the duties, <br /> responsibilities, and minimum qualifications for the proposed <br /> position. The Department of Human Resource Management shall <br /> assign the position to one of the job titles in the Position <br /> Classification Plan. If a suitable job description is needed, the <br /> Director of Human Resource Management in cooperation with the <br /> department shall develop a new job description and title for <br /> consideration by the City Manager. <br /> <br />f.
